Nobody likes to wait – especially for giant robots. That's why even though the June 24 release date of "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en" is just weeks away, there are already have several opportunities for fans to enhance their movie-going experience. Film aficionados may already know about "TF2" Director Michael Bay's announcement that the film will contain bonus material on IMAX screens, but now there's not only two comic miniseries expanding the backstory, but part one of the straight up movie adaptation all available on the iPhone.

Read more about TF2 on the smallest screen after the jump!IDW's two four-issue movie prequels "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en: Alliance" and "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en: Defiance" hit brick and mortar comics stores a few months back, but could now be headed for a broader audience via Apple's mobile devices.

For those who have already dissected "TF2"'s trailers, commercials and posters, "Alliance" and "Defiance" offer a few new glimpses into the upcoming film. Anyone who has taken a look at the film's new toys might wonder what the deal is with the plastic pilot chilling inside Optimus Prime's vehicle mode, and "Alliance" offers a clear explanation. Also, those who hated the blatant product placement of the first film will likely consider the opening scene in "Alliance's" first issue well worth the price of admission.

Those who lack the patience to simply read online spoilers from overseas premiers (and the pirated copies soon to follow) can also go the comic route and preview the first quarter of the film in "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en" number one on the iPhone now. All issues cost $0.99 a piece, meaning catching up on every IDW offering nets less than a single movie ticket. Take that, IMAX.
